-
0 votesanswersviews
通过Maven运行测试脚本时的问题
当我通过maven测试执行我的测试脚本时,它显示错误 . 以下是运行时的错误 . [INFO]扫描项目... [INFO] [INFO] ---------------------------------- -------------------------------------- [INFO]建设Talentrack V1 [INFO] --- -----------------------... -
11 votesanswersviews
IE11上的Selenium WebDriver
我使用WebDriver自动化我们的webapp的回归套件,我试图让我的测试脚本与IE11一起运行,但没有取得任何成功 . 我了解IEDriverServer.exe目前不支持WebDriver,这个问题需要Microsoft的合作,我已经尝试了对Selenium问题#6511的回复中概述的步骤 . (仅对于IE 11,您需要在目标计算机上设置一个注册表项,以便驱动程序可以维护与其创建的Inte... -
1 votesanswersviews
IE11在Selenium发布时失败,“Netscape不支持请使用Internet Explorer”错误
我有一个很老的网站需要维护,支持IE8及以上版本 . 现在,我计划使用Selenium WebDriver(版本3.7.1)在网站上进行一些测试自动化 . 除了一些使用document.getElementById()的页面外,几乎所有内容都运行良好 . 关键是,这些页面利用IE11的"feature",当没有元素与指定的ID匹配时,它返回具有该ID作为名称的元素(如this ... -
1 votesanswersviews
如何查看在Windows 7服务器上运行的jenkins slave上运行的selenium测试?
我们有一个构建环境,其中Jenkins在linux服务器上运行 . 为了在Windows特定项目上运行某些集成测试,我们将Windows 7服务器vm设置为hudson slave . 这个设置都正常工作 . 这些集成测试由一组硒测试组成,为了诊断故障,见证测试运行是有用的 . 当通过RDC连接到服务器时,使用相同的用户名,主服务器正在运行从服务器,我看不到测试正在运行,并且Jenkins从服务器... -
0 votesanswersviews
如何使用Jenkins / Maven运行我的硒测试?
我在运行Ubuntu的本地机器上设置了Jenkins,指向我的jdk,maven,创建了一个工作来运行我的Selenium测试并给它指向项目中pom.xml的路径,但是当我尝试运行这个工作时,它马上就失败了 . 控制台输出读取 在工作区中构建/ var / lib / jenkins / workspace / new job [新作业] $ / usr / share / maven2 / b... -
0 votesanswersviews
在Linux机器上通过jenkins运行selenium脚本时,firefox没有启动
我正在设置linux环境下的jenkins(hudson) . 运行我的selenium脚本 . 所以我在jenkins中配置一个作业,我从svn中获取代码,然后我启动selenium服务器,然后调用ant来运行我的脚本 . 但是当我运行这个工作时,我的selenium服务器开始内联,但firefox没有启动 . 所以我在谷歌上检查他们说要使用Xvfb . 我已经在Linux机器上安装了Xvfb,... -
7 votesanswersviews
Sikuli,詹金斯的硒测试:允许浏览器在前台启动,就像我从开发机器运行它一样?
问题在于,Sikuli的图像识别功能仅在Sikuli测试的目标位于前景并且可以完全访问鼠标时才起作用 . 在其当前配置中,Jenkins项目永远不会从Windows从属节点的桌面上看到 . 我现在的自动化测试套件的设置方式,仅使用selenium编写了大约30个测试 . 在最后的两个测试中,selenium启动了一个webdriver(目前是chromedriver但可以是firefox或IE)并... -
0 votesanswersviews
用Jenkins启动浏览器[重复]
这个问题在这里已有答案: Jenkins : Selenium GUI tests are not visible on Windows 7个答案 在Win7上配置Jenkins(使用Tomcat)以启动我的maven命令 . 使用My maven命令,我将启动selenium测试脚本,启动web broswer并执行测试用例 . 问题:当我使用Jenkins构建triger时,构建开始并在J... -
0 votesanswersviews
Xvfb正常运行,但我收到此错误:“错误:没有指定显示” . 只有当我从詹金斯进行硒测试时
我有一个CentOS 6.5服务器,安装了jenkins和Xvfb firefox并正常运行 . 我正在尝试从jenkins运行一些selenium测试,当我构建jenkins工作时我遇到了这个错误: org.openqa.selenium.firefox.NotConnectedException:45000 ms后无法在端口7056上连接到主机127.0.0.1 . Firefox控制台输... -
5 votesanswersviews
用Jenkins运行无头firefox Xvfb来运行selenium测试
我在FreeBSD服务器上的Jenkins中运行play框架测试时遇到 Error: no display specified 错误 . 所以每次我都面临超时 org.openqa.selenium.firefox.NotConnectedException: Unable to connect to host 127.0.0.1 on port 7055 after 45000 ms. Fire... -
1 votesanswersviews
詹金斯正在进行量角器测试
我正试图用硒和量角器进行量角器测试 . 要在我的电脑上执行此操作,我将在控制台1上启动selenium服务器: webdriver-manager update webdriver-manager start 然后在控制台2上我启动测试: protractor test.config.js 我想在詹金斯做同样的事情 . 问题是,启动硒后我无法做任何事情,因为控制台在运行selenium服务器时... -
0 votesanswersviews
詹金斯硒不会无头地进行测试
我正在使用jenkins运行pytests selenium测试 . 我在我的本地机器上运行测试 . 但是当我运行jenkins时,它会在远程jenkins机器上运行(在远程jenkins机器上创建工作空间),并且它会因为“元素不可见”或“由于元素无法点击而导致超时异常”等测试错误而失败 . 在此之后,我在工作区中直接在远程机器上运行测试(Windows服务器) . 它启动了chrome浏览器并运... -
0 votesanswersviews
无法通过Docker中的Jenkins运行selenium测试
所以我有Ubuntu的VM . 主机在Win10上 . 在这个VM里面,我安装了一个docker,在那里我拉了jenkins并为jenkins安装了selenium插件 . 我可以从win10到达一个selenium节点 . 但是当我尝试从我的IDE启动测试时: val cap: DesiredCapabilities = DesiredCapabilities.chrome() cap.set... -
0 votesanswersviews
我无法使用selenium webdriver在网表中迭代数据
List <WebElement> rnum = dr.findElements(By.xpath("//*[@id='leftcontainer']/table/tbody/tr")); for(int i=1;i<rnum.size();i++){ List <WebElement> rowcells ... -
-3 votesanswersviews
如何在java中使用web驱动程序在selenium中单击按钮时使用Alert框[duplicate]
这个问题在这里已有答案: Alert handling in Selenium WebDriver (selenium 2) with Java 5个答案 请帮助我Tester,我很沮丧这一点我已经应用了越来越多的代码,但没有再找到解决方案和相同的消息显示 . .................................................. ................... -
0 votesanswersviews
无法在Jenkins中使用IE 10/11运行selenium脚本,但对FF来说很好
我正在尝试使用Jenkins中的IE 10/11运行selenium脚本(Jenkins作为Windows服务运行),并且发生在错误之下 . 对此有何建议?顺便说一句,当它从命令行启动jenkins时,不会发生此错误 . org.openqa.selenium.NoSuchElementException:无法找到id == outerForm:headerDate的元素(警告:服务器未提供任何... -
0 votesanswersviews
Webdriver预期条件失败:等待元素不再是visiblr
我有一个等待css(模态)定位器在屏幕上不可见的方法,在我的一些构建中我得到以下失败的消息 预期条件失败:等待元素不再可见:By.cssSelector:.modal-body(尝试6秒,间隔500 MILLISECONDS)构建信息:版本:'3.4.0',修订版:'未知',time:'unknown'系统信息:主机:'DEV007',ip:'172.16.2.192',os.name:'Win... -
0 votesanswersviews
从属性文件中传递黄瓜特征文件的数据表中的值
我想从属性文件中传递特征文件的数据表中的变量值 . 这是我写的,但它给了我错误..下面的完整堆栈跟踪 org.openqa.selenium.WebDriverException:未知错误:keys应该是一个字符串 featurefile Scenario: Capture a user and check user details Given Opens the userdetails, s... -
1 votesanswersviews
在MAC OS 10.6上安装Protractor的错误
有关此安装的任何帮助吗? $ npm i protractor -g | > utf-8-validate@1.2.1 install /usr/local/lib/node_modules/protractor/node_modules/selenium-webdriver/node_modules/ws/node_modules/utf-8-validate > node-gyp ... -
5 votesanswersviews
如何通过编程方式将Selenese(html)转换为Python?
如何在不导出每个测试用例的情况下将Selenium IDE制作的测试用例转换为Python?那个工作有没有命令行转换器? 最后我想使用Selenium RC和Pythons构建单元测试来测试我的网站 . 非常感谢 . Update: 我开始编写一个转换器,但实现所有命令的工作太多了 . 有没有更好的方法? from xml.dom.minidom import parse class Selen... -
0 votesanswersviews
从Selenium Java测试脚本到MySQL数据库的连接失败
我正在尝试使用以下程序连接到MySQL数据库 . 根据我呈现连接字符串的方式,我会收到以下错误 . IP地址仅从':'与'mysql'分隔:conn = DriverManager.getConnection(“jdbc:mysql:[valid ip address] / localhost:3306 / [valid database name]”,“[valid username]”,“[有... -
0 votesanswersviews
使用远程'chromedriver.exe'文件设置Chrome WebDriver
我的系统中安装了chrome . 我正在使用Selenium对chrome进行一些测试 . 我已将Chromedriver.exe下载到MyDocuments . 我使用System.setProperty()设置了'webdriver.chrome.driver'并启动了ChromeDriver() . 它工作正常 . System.setProperty("webdriver.chr... -
0 votesanswersviews
在eclipse中设置Chrome驱动程序路径,在Windows中设置系统变量以在MAC上执行
我有一个要求在chrome - Mac机器上运行自动化脚本 我的所有自动化代码库都在Windows 7上 我在Mac上下载了chrome驱动程序,在mac上创建了selenium网格节点,并在测试脚本中配置了目标mac url . 接下来的步骤是添加System.setProperty(“webdriver.chrome.driver”..)在Windows机器中下载chrome驱动程序并将路... -
0 votesanswersviews
在selenium 2.4.2中添加Chrome驱动程序时出错
在Selenium 2.4.2中添加以下代码 System.setProperty( “webdriver.chrome.driver”, “d://chromedriver_win32//chromedriver.exe”); WebDriver driver = new ChromeDriver(); chrome窗口被打开但是'某些黄色警告消息显示为' - 您正在使用不受支持的命令行标志: ... -
2 votesanswersviews
如何在桌面浏览器上使用webdriver移动网络
我使用selenium webdriver进行AUT(应用程序测试)的功能测试自动化 . AUT是响应式网络,我几乎完成了桌面浏览器的不同测试用例 . 现在相同的测试用例也适用于移动浏览器,因为可以从移动浏览器访问AUT . 因为当我们在移动浏览器中打开时它是响应式web,所以UI具有一些不同的表示 . 所以我们也需要为移动浏览器运行这些测试 . 对于使用safari浏览器的用户代理功能的手动测... -
4 votesanswersviews
使用Selenium进行Gitlab持续集成测试
我正在开发一个项目,使用 .gitlab-ci.yml 构建,测试和部署应用程序到 Cloud 端 1) Build the backend and frontend using pip install and npm install build_backend: image: python stage: build script: - pip install requiremen... -
0 votesanswersviews
以块的形式下载大量文件
我试图通过提供输入列表在Firefox中使用Python Selenium下载一堆(数千个)文件 . 我正在下载成功 . 由于我想下载数千个文件,我想知道你是否可以建议一种方法来开始下载10个文件,等到它们完成并开始下一个10.我怎么能这样做? 下载完成后我尝试 fp.set_preference("browser.download.manager.closeWhenDone"... -
1 votesanswersviews
Python selenium在没有条件的情况下等待页面加载
我想让selenium在拍摄截图之前等待 . 当我使用time.sleep(1)时,它给了我这个错误: 回溯(最近一次调用最后一次):文件“test.py”,第12行,在driver.save_screenshot('page.png')文件“/Library/Frameworks/Python.framework/Versions/3.6/lib/python3.6/ site-packages... -
6 votesanswersviews
如何使用Selenium2Library计算带有Robot Framework的表中的td / tr数
我正在使用Robot Framework自动检查表中的TD或TR的数量 . 我正在使用来自Selenium的Get Matching XPath Count关键字,但是它总是失败并出现错误 . 我的示例HTML结构: <table id="myTable"> <tr> <td style="width: 50%"... -
1 votesanswersviews
XPath表达式中的正则表达式[重复]
这个问题在这里已有答案: Is string matches() supported in Selenium Webdriver 2? 2个答案 我有一些HTML代码: <div> <div id="order-1"></div> <div id="order-2"></div> <...